The Spring Concert was on March 8, 2012 in the auditorium.
The program featured the Orchestra, Combined Symphony Orchestra, Concert Band and the Jazz Band.
The Orchestra preformed works by L. Gabrielle and W. A. Mozart.
The Combined Symphony Orchestra played an Isaac arrangement of Rimsy-Korsakov's Fandango and Alborada
The Concert Band preformed works by Darren Jenkins, Ed Kimbrough, Pierre Leemans, Shelly Hanson and a James Swearington arrangement of America the Beautiful.
The Jazz Band played a number of standards arranged by Frank Mantooth.
